Petrobras Signs Historic Marine Biofuel Supply Deal With Odfjell
ZACKS· 2026-01-20 14:40
Key Takeaways PBR will supply up to 12,000 metric tons of B24 biofuel to Odfjell's fleet during 2026.B24 combines 24% biofuel with VLSFO, helping lower emissions without changing vessel infrastructure.The deal supports Petrobras' 2026-2030 plan to expand its presence in low-carbon energy markets.Petrobras (PBR) , one of Brazil's largest energy companies, has announced a significant agreement with the Norwegian shipping giant, Odfjell, to supply B24 marine biofuel. Scientists Pointing to Hidden Power Source That Could Reshape Future of AI

Core Insights - Global electricity demand is at a critical juncture, with the International Energy Agency (IEA) projecting that global data-center electricity use will nearly double by 2030, and AI-focused facilities will see their consumption increase more than four times during the same period [1] - The primary constraint in energy supply is shifting from data throughput and semiconductor performance to electricity availability [1] - Natural hydrogen, a geologically sourced form of hydrogen, is gaining attention as a potential scalable, low-carbon baseload solution to meet the rising power demands of the AI era [1] Company Insights - MAX Power Mining Corp. has become the first publicly traded company in North America to secure a significant 1.3-million-acre land position specifically for natural hydrogen exploration and development [1] - The company is advancing towards establishing a commercial-scale natural hydrogen well, positioning itself at the forefront of this emerging energy sector [1] - MAX Power aims to align itself with established innovators in the AI landscape, such as Amazon, Meta, Tesla, and Broadcom [1]
